Job Description:
ThePlant Manager directs and manages all plant operations, including overall responsibility for production, maintenance, safety, quality and warehouse operations. This leader will also drive continuous improvement in the operations by applying the principles of LEAN manufacturing to production and warehouse processes.
Job Responsibilities:
- Directs and manages plant operations for production, maintenance, safety, quality, and shipping departments.
- Drives continuous improvement projects and KAIZEN activity by engaging the employees and implementing new processes to enhance operating performance.
- Coordinates plant activities through planning with departmental managers to ensure that the total manufacturing objectives are accomplished in a timely and cost-effective manner.
- Implements cost effective systems of control over expenses, capital, expenditures, manpower, wages and salaries.
- Establishes and monitors overall plant performance for key metrics such as On Time Delivery, production efficiency, safety and quality.
- Maintains and /or upgrades existing plant facilities and equipment including the replacement of, or adjustments to plant facilities and equipment when necessary.
- Implements and maintains preventative maintenance programs.
- Provides direction, development, and leadership to subordinates.
Minimum Qualifications:
- Bachelor's degree in Operations Management, Engineering or a related field and five years of plant/general management experience.
- Working knowledge of budgets and financial statements.
- Thorough knowledge of safety laws and regulations.
- Experience with best practices / LEAN manufacturing /Six-Sigma training and / or certification in these areas.
- Demonstrated ability to communicate effectively both verbally and in writing.
